One of the most underrated tanks of the Second World War, the Matilda was a heavy British infantry tank designed to support troop assaults against enemy positions, and during early Second World War engagements, proved to be exceptional in this role.
In the Western Desert, it became the scourge of the Italian Army, earning the nickname the ‘Queen of the Desert’.

The British Army’s main Battle Tank from the late 1960s until the 1990s, the Chieftain was developed to counter the latest Soviet heavy tanks, but with firepower being its primary consideration.
The Chieftain featured a powerful and incredibly accurate 120mm gun, with British crews posting impressively high first hit rate performance when using it during training.
Thankfully, this Cold War sentinel never had to fire its main gun in anger.

The first all-German tank to appear since the Second World War, the Leopard was chosen by Belgium, Holland, and West Germany.
Designed for speed, mobility, and firepower, it became one of NATO’s most successful main battle tanks – a true icon now recreated in classic Airfix model form.

The Centurion Mk.8 was one of Britain’s most successful post-war tanks, combining heavy armour with excellent mobility and firepower. Serving in numerous conflicts worldwide, it set the standard for modern tank design.

A hugely successful 6X6 armoured personnel carrier introduced by the British Army during the early 1950s, the Saracen protected its two-man crew and squad of 10 troops when they were sent into hostile environments around the world, earning a reputation as one of the most effective and reliable military vehicles of the post war era.

Introduced in the early 1970s, the Bedford MK FV 4x4 General Service Truck saw widespread service providing vital mobility for the British Army, whilst also being developed to fulfil several specialist roles.
As an aircraft refueller, they serviced RAF and Army Air Corps helicopters and Harriers, particularly when they were being operated in off-airfield, tactical situations.

One of the first mass-produced British tanks of the 1930s, the Vickers Light Tank was essentially an armoured reconnaissance vehicle. It was manufactured to an extremely high standard, with two Vickers machine guns mounted in its turret, although they couldn’t be fired at the same time.
Used extensively by the BEF in France and in the Western Desert at the start of the Second World War, these reliable little tanks were no match for the firepower of the latest German and Italian guns. However, you can now build your own Vickers LIght Tank vehicle with this 1:76 model kit.
